Much of the opposition to the Singletary pick is from folks who think you can get a RB anywhere. For reference, the Pats took RB Sony Michell in the 2nd last year and he played a considerable role in their Super Bowl run. This year they added ANOTHER RB in round 3 (Damien Harris). The league runs in cycles. A trend takes effect until some contrarian goes the other way. I remember RBs being the centerpiece of an NFL offense. Then big receivers became the rage and defenses got bigger in the secondary. Then offenses went to “smurf” WRs that the big DBs could not handle. So, defenses went to smaller quicker DBs. And so on... Today, defenses are countering the spread offense with smaller faster LBs and DL who specialize in rushing the passer. So, the Pats are now out ahead of that curve subtly building a bully offense that can run the ball to take advantage of the smaller, lighter DL and LBs. -
